c8d150dbaa Various build system clean-ups and simplifications:
- Created Makefile.tool-tests.am, put standard AM_CFLAGS et al for tests in
  it.
- A number of tests are shared between Helgrind and DRD.  They used to be
  built in both directories.  Now they are only built in helgrind/tests/,
  and the DRD .vgtest files just point to the executable in helgrind/tests/.
  Most of these (about 30) had the source files in helgrind/tests/;  I moved
  the three that were in drd/tests/ into helgrind/tests/ for consistency.
- Fixed rwlock_test, which was failing to run due to a wrong name in the
  .vgtest file.
- Removed remnants of unused 'hello' test for Memcheck.
- Avoided redundant flag specification in various places, esp.
  memcheck/tests/Makefile.am.
- Removed unnecessary _AIX guards in some Linux-only tests.
